The non-Fricke vertex superalgebra conjecture

Let M\mathbb{M} be the Monster group, let gMg\in\mathbb{M} be non-Fricke, and let gV^{}^g\hat V be the module assigned to gg in the proposed unified Moonshine construction. Non-Fricke vertex superalgebra conjecture. If gg is non-Fricke, then gV^{}^g\hat V is a vertex superalgebra. The source reports this as an extension of known prime-order cases; the general assertion is not stated as resolved.
